On “Talk”, the second single from Why Don’t We’s debut album "8 Letters", the boys of Why Don’t We discuss the problems within their relationships, which stem from their poor communication. The song was teased through an Instagram post just one day before the song dropped, and announced ten hours before the song was due to release in the United States. The song peaked at #1 on the American iTunes Chart just 12 hours after the song was released in the States. Why Don't We (commonly abbreviated as WDW) was an American pop quintet that was assembled on September 27, 2016, consisting of Jonah Marais, Corbyn Besson, Daniel Seavey, Jack Avery, and Zach Herron, each of whom had previously recorded as solo artists. Their fandom name was called "Limelights" due to a lyric from their debut single. Because of a lawsuit, the group took a hiatus and cancelled their tour in 2022, and eventually lost the rights to the group name in February 2025, marking the official end of the group.
